Nordy Big Singles or Fat Stacks?

Good choice! No matter which Nordstrands you go with, I think that you will be happy. I have a big single in one of my basses and I have played a Nordy with the fat stacks. I noticed that the big singles are mean with a slight bump in the mids. They really cut through in a rock setting and are extremely sensitive to your dynamics.
Fat stacks are a bit more refined and I think more even across the frequency spectrum. Slightly less output but dead silent since there are two coils. I'm sure that you will like either one better than those silly Barts.

The Fat Stacks and OBP-3 pre in my Fretless Valenti are very flexible. Full, meaty, clean, growly when I want it, clear mids & bottom, refined top...stop me....I can't imagine pickups I would like better in this instrument--it has an ebony fingerboard, and TI flats tuned EADGC.

However, I have zero experience with any other Nordstrands except for reviews I have read, so YMMV.
